As the topic indicates, I'm having a strange audio issue. I've recently wired the front panel of my case up to the motherboard, and it seems like it's working - the headphones and microphone jack both work.
The problem is a small one, but nagging - some sounds still use the internal speakers, sounds that shouldn't. The beep that the volume slider makes, for example, and the sound the Gnotify (the gmail notifier program) uses to announce an email.
Any idea what might be causing this? For the record, I have a Biostar I915P-A7 motherboard and I've tried reinstalling the audio drivers. The case is wired straight to it and I'm not using a sound card. The wires from the case are individual (not fused together in a single plug) so I may well have put them onto the wrong points, but now that the sound is (mostly) working I'm not too keen to go fiddling without being sure that that's what the problem is.
